Announced: Panasonic GH4 – 4K for the Masses

Earlier today Panasonic announced its long awaited GH4 advanced mirrorless camera. This is the latest model from the GH hybrid (video and stills oriented) cameras and it brings a host of new improvements over the GH3 primarily in the video department with it a capability to shoot 4K videos – for the first time in any mirrorless camera (and something that you can currently only find on the Canon 1DC on the DSLR side).

Here are some of the main features of the Panasonic GH4:

  • Sensor: A new 16.05 MP Live MOS (micro 4/3).
  • Image processor: New quad-core imaging processor – Venus Engine 9AHD.
  • Sensitivity: 200-25,600 ISO (improved over the GH3).
  • Shutter speed: 60- 1/8000 seconds.
  • Viewfinder: digital – 2,359K-Dot OLED Live.
  • LCD: Tilting 3.0″ 1,036k-Dot OLED Monitor.
  • Wireless Connectivity: Wi-Fi/NFC.
  • Advanced features: Focus Peaking,  silent mode, Highlight/Shadow Control, RAW data development in Camera and more.
  • Shooting speed: up to 12fps burst shooting  (AF-S) and up to  7.0fps in continuous AF (up to 40 images buffer in RAW).
  • AF: Face / Eye Detection AF or 49-point AF with Custom Multi AF mode (up to 00.7 AF with the new Depth From Defocus” (DFD) technology – currently only with Panasonic lenses).
  • Flash: Built-in/external flash (sync speed max.1/250 second).
  • Video: 4K video in MOV & MP4 (resolutions include:  4K 24p  – 4096×2160, 4K – 3840×2160 30p/24p.
  • More video: 4:2:0 internal SD recording / 4:2:2 out to external recording devices (4K – 100Mbps Bitrate, 1080p – up to 200Mbps; ALL-Intra or IPB Compression).
  • Sound: 3.5mm headphone jack for live audio monitoring while recording (many more options for connections including XLRs SDIs micro HDMI with the optional DMW-YAGH /AG-YAGH –  attachable interface unit).
  • Storage: a single SD UHS Speed Class 3 (U3) – 30 MB/sec data stream guaranteed.
  • Price and availability: not yet announced (Panasonic all but promised that the camera will cost under $2K later this year).
